If I am disabled due to illness or disability after an accident, I can have this situation recognized . By being recognized as having a disability, I can benefit from appropriate assistance. It is important that I discuss this with my doctor .
➡️ How to do it?
To have my disability recognized, I must contact the Departmental House for Disabled Persons (MDPH) . There is an MDPH in each department. I have to contact the MDPH of the department in which I live. I must send the MDPH an application form , containing a medical certificate to be completed by a doctor.
In addition to requesting recognition of the disability, I can express specific needs and requests for assistance. The MDPH will also study these requests.
When the MDPH recognizes a disability, it recognizes a level of incapacity. If I have a disability rate of 50% or 80% I am entitled to special assistance.
➡️ What help can I get?
The rights and assistance offered by the MDPH can be :
- Recognition of the status of disabled worker allowing the right to specific support in the job search and adaptation of the workstation ;
- The Allowance for Disabled Adults (AAH) , corresponding to financial assistance calculated according to resources (€903.6 per month maximum) for people with a recognized disability rate of more than 80% or for people with a disability rate of more than 50% with recognized difficulty in accessing employment ;
- A Disability Compensation Benefit (PCH) allowing you to obtain assistance in daily life ;
- The Disabled Child Education Allowance (AEEH) which compensates for the costs of education and care provided to a disabled child.
- Referral to a medical accommodation facility if necessary ;
- A Mobility Inclusion Card which allows me to have priority in accessing a seat on transport or to have priority in queues;
- Etc.
⚠️ I do not need to have a residence permit to be recognized as having a disability. Please note, however, I need a residence permit to obtain the assistance offered by the MPDH.
